The Telegraph Hotel
157 Corporate Street, Coventry, CV1 1GU
A very modern hotel in a former newspaper building, this is local to various attractions such as the Coventry Transport Museum and is close to the train station. The rooms are decorated in a modern yet retro way that only adds to the whole atmosphere of the hotel.
Coombe Abbey Hotel
Brinklow Road, Binley, Coventry, CV3 2AB
This hotel is located in an old country house and is just a short drive from the local golf course and the Cathedral. Relax with a walk through the extensive grounds and lake and enjoy some afternoon tea in the restaurant.

Coventry Cathedral
Priory Street, Coventry CV1 5AB
The seat of the Bishop of Coventry for the Church of England and a museum and archive center for various relics important to Coventry. There are various interesting symbols of reconciliation including the Charred Cross and the Cross of Nails.
Brandon Marsh Nature Reserve
Brandon Marsh Nature Center, Brandon Lane, Coventry CV3 3GW
Take a walk around this stunning nature reserve and take in the peace and tranquility that surrounds you so close to the city center. It has 220 acres that can be explored and is full of large pools, bird hides and meadows. Grab your walking boots and head on out.
